Leading through service: 2026 Nationwide CEO Award winners celebrated
From helping homeowners identify coverage gaps and finding new ways for families to protect their financial futures to spending hundreds of hours volunteering in their communities, Nationwide employees continue to make a meaningful difference every day for customers, coworkers and the communities where they live and work.
At Nationwide’s annual company-wide meeting, employees gathered in-person and virtually to celebrate the 2026 CEO Award winners whose contributions reflect the company’s mission of protecting people, businesses and futures with extraordinary care. In the company’s centennial year, their stories are a reminder that caring for others has been at the heart of Nationwide throughout its history.
A Nationwide CEO Award is considered one of the company’s highest honors, recognizing employees who go above and beyond. Nearly 100 employees were nominated.
“Each year, these awards give us the opportunity to recognize people who represent the very best of our company, those who lead by example and help make Nationwide a stronger community partner,” said Nationwide CEO Kirt Walker. “Their commitment to customers, the community, each other and moving our business forward is nothing short of inspiring. Their work reflects our mission in action and demonstrates how powerful it is when talent, compassion and purpose come together.”
